How to make it

  • 1. Cake: Heat oven to 350 degrees F. Coat two 5-3/4 x 3 x 2-1/8-inch mini loaf pans with nonstick cooking spray.
  • 2. In a large bowl, whisk flour, sugar and salt. Set aside.
  • 3. Bring 1 cup water to a boil in a small saucepan over medium-high heat. Add dates, shortening, baking soda and vanilla. Stir until shortening is melted. Remove from heat; stir into dry ingredients. Add egg and beat with a wooden spoon until all ingredients are combined. Stir in walnuts.
  • 4. Divide between prepared loaf pans. Bake at 350 degrees F for 40 to 45 minutes or until a toothpick inserted in center comes out clean. Cool in pan on rack for 10 minutes. Turn out onto rack; cool completely.
  • 5. Frosting: Heat broiler. In a small saucepan, melt butter and sugar. Stir in cream and coconut. Spread frosting equally over the two loaves. Broil for 1 to 1-1/2 minutes until lightly browned. Let loaves cool completely.
  • 6. To present as a gift, place cooled cake in decorative tin or wrap in pretty paper.
